**Ticket: Spooler config drift on print-relay nodes**

Heads up, support folks — the Inkwell spooler microservice on the Dunmore floor nodes has drifted from what's in the repo again. Jobs queue fine but retries behave weirdly. Quick fix until ops re-bakes the image: manually reset each node to the canonical values below.

deployment values, kafof-yaguf:
wenael:
  log_level: warn
  metrics_host: metrics.wenael.zemvarsys.internal
  pin: 0240
  pool_size: 32

Runbook: account recovery — StormRelay fan-out (Quillhaven Weather). Fan-out runs under a dedicated service account. If the account is locked, alert delivery halts within 90 seconds. Verify lockout in the auth console, then invoke the recovery flow from a hardened host only. Two-person approval required; log the incident before proceeding. The recovery flow will prompt for the service account's recovery passphrase, shown on the next line.

unlock words, yawig-kagef: gordor-holvan-ulaael-pramir-ulaiel-tamdor

Alert: tenant quota breach on the Mistgate API. One tenant on the Harborline plan blew past their per-minute rate quota by 12x, and the limiter let a burst through before clamping down. Could be a misconfigured client, could be something sketchier — that's why this routes to security review. The limiter logs request signatures and source regions, so attribution should be straightforward. The quota policy and investigation checklist are on the internal page below.

runbook for badug-kadup: https://confluence.zemvarlabs.internal/projects/browse/display/projects/bd1b

**Ticket: Config drift on QueryHive resolvers after N+1 fix**

For the weekly sync: the batching patch Marit shipped to the QueryHive GraphQL layer eliminated the N+1 on the `orders → lineItems` resolver, but staging and prod now disagree on loader cache settings. Staging was hand-edited during testing and never reconciled. To close this out we need both environments aligned to the canonical values. The agreed baseline is listed below.

deployment values, fafog-fawip:
[jorox]
team = fendor
access_code = ac_bb00ea
host = jorox.qorveltech.internal
port = 9200
owner = istdor.aldeth
peer = julvan.orvexlabs.internal